Our take

The opening feels sharp and a bit rough, with clary sage and lavender hitting at once in a way that leans more medicinal than calm. It does not ease you in. The bitter almond quickly joins, adding a dry, almost dusty edge that keeps the vanilla from feeling smooth. Leather sits in the middle of it all, stiff and uncured, giving the blend a heavy hand that some will find too blunt for daily wear. The sweetness tries to rise, but the aromatic herbs push back, creating a tension that never fully settles.
